Wooden pallets are versatile, strong, and eco-friendly. They are a cost-effective type of transportation for different products, from food items to electronic devices. In addition, the wood used in pallets can be recycled or recycled, making them a sustainable option compared to plastic or metal options.
| Benefit | Description |
|---|---|
| Sustainability | Made from renewable resources and completely recyclable. |
| Cost Efficiency | Less costly than alternative materials like plastic. |
| Strength | Can manage heavy loads and withstand substantial impact. |
| Personalization | Easily modified for particular requirements, such as size and strength. |
| Eco-Friendly | Eco-friendly and can be repurposed after their lifecycle. |

Wooden pallets are mostly used for shipping and storing products. They prevail in warehouses, factories, and retail facilities.
The weight capacity of a wooden pallet can vary. Standard pallets normally hold between 1,500 to 3,000 pounds, while custom-made pallets can hold much more.
Wooden pallets can be recycled in numerous ways; they can be repaired for reuse, broken down into chips for landscaping, or repurposed into furniture and construction products.
When purchasing used pallets, inspect them for damage, check for any indications of contamination, and verify that they fulfill safety requirements.
Yes, organizations like the International Plant Protection Convention (IPPC) impose heat treatment and fumigation requirements for pallets used in global shipping to avoid the spread of pests.
